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 82404 365417699 453608 391815
80657915115 038676
80657915115 038676
271 227 76
All about undefined
Interested in learning more?
80657915115 038676
271 227 76
See more
12270512 5421620
85 55424 16 6178 65
See more
9183 366 837
98520 805851392 32 39 087728
See more